DashGo é uma aplicação em React para dashboard's em geral com paginas e paginação, login e sistema de inclusão de usuarios

Overview

Ignite

Ignite - Trilha ReactJS

dashgo

Sobre o projeto

O projeto foi baseado no 4º módulo da trilha ReactJS do Ignite. Além do que foi construído na aula, foi criado um banco de dados com o Prisma, um CRUD de usuários e um sistema de autenticação baseado na aula de autenticação e autorização.

🚀 Como executar

  • Clone o repositório
  • Instale as dependências com yarn
  • Rode as migrations com yarn prisma db push
  • Rode as seeds com yarn seed
  • Inicie o servidor com yarn dev
  • Agora você pode acessar localhost:3000 do seu navegador.
You might also like...

Vtexio-react-apps - Apps react para plafaforma VTEX.

Vtexio-react-apps - Apps react para plafaforma VTEX.

Projeto Modal + Apps Extras Projeto modal setando cookies. Desenvolvido em React + TypeScript para aplicação em e-commerce VTEXIO. 🚨 Este projeto se

Jan 3, 2022

Recipe providing mobile app, User selects ingredients in pantry and is then provided recipes for those ingredients. App contains a signup/login, meal planner and grocery list pages.

Recipog Student Information Name Connor de Bruyn Username Destiro Assignment SWEN325 A2 Description “Recipog” is a recipe providing app that allows th

Dec 26, 2021

Boilerplate for a NextJS and Supabase Project. Including full authentication with sign up, login and password recovery.

NextJS x Supabase Boilerplate Getting Started Environment variables Create the enviroment variables with the following command cp .env.local.dist .env

Jun 13, 2022

The Project is a test that simulates a website of recipes for healthy foods. Inside it has a Registration and Login system.

The Project is a test that simulates a website of recipes for healthy foods. Inside it has a Registration and Login system.

GCB Test: Healthy Eating The Project is a test that simulates a website of recipes for healthy foods. Inside it has a Registration and Login system. C

Nov 20, 2022

This solution aims to simplify the implementation of login using SPID or similar services, such as CIE and eIDAS

This solution aims to simplify the implementation of login using SPID or similar services, such as CIE and eIDAS. It supports both the use of ADFS and B2C as identity federators.

Dec 2, 2022

Uma simples pokédex que consome os dados da PokeAPI.

Uma simples pokédex que consome os dados da PokeAPI.

POKEDEX - Caio Almeida Uma pokedex consumindo os dados provindos da API pública: PokeAPI. Protótipo FIGMA Pokedex FIGMA Pré-requisitos Ter o NodeJS in

Dec 29, 2021

Fiz uma validação de senhas no Front-End usando RegEx!

Fiz uma validação de senhas no Front-End usando RegEx!

Seja bem vindo a um dos meus #JokeCodes Nesse código vou te mostrar como fazer uma validação de senha no Front-End, com feedback na tela de login!, us

Oct 5, 2022

Recoil is an experimental state management library for React apps. It provides several capabilities that are difficult to achieve with React alone, while being compatible with the newest features of React.

Recoil · Recoil is an experimental set of utilities for state management with React. Please see the website: https://recoiljs.org Installation The Rec

Jan 8, 2023

Juego del ahorcado en JS, reto del programa ONE para la vitrina Alura Latam

Juego del ahorcado en JS, reto del programa ONE para la vitrina Alura Latam

Juego del ahorcado - JavaScript Programa ONE Nahuel-DevOne Información del proyecto: Este es mi segundo proyecto para el programa ONE de Oracle + Alur

Oct 4, 2022
Comments
  • Erro Token

    Erro Token

    yarn seed yarn run v1.22.17 error Command "seed" not found.

    Depois de rodar o yarn dev Error [InvalidTokenError] at Object. (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\jwt-decode\build\jwt-decode.cjs.js:1:1147) at Module._compile (internal/modules/cjs/loader.js:1085:14) at Object.Module._extensions..js (internal/modules/cjs/loader.js:1114:10) at Module.load (internal/modules/cjs/loader.js:950:32) at Function.Module._load (internal/modules/cjs/loader.js:790:12) at Module.require (internal/modules/cjs/loader.js:974:19) at require (internal/modules/cjs/helpers.js:93:18) at Object.jwt-decode (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:279:18) at webpack_require (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:23:31) at Module../src/pages/api/me.ts (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:209:68) at webpack_require (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:23:31) at C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:91:18 at Object. (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:94:10) at Module._compile (internal/modules/cjs/loader.js:1085:14) at Object.Module._extensions..js (internal/modules/cjs/loader.js:1114:10) at Module.load (internal/modules/cjs/loader.js:950:32) { message: "Invalid token specified: Cannot read property 'replace' of undefined" } Error [ERR_HTTP_HEADERS_SENT]: Cannot set headers after they are sent to the client at new NodeError (internal/errors.js:322:7) at ServerResponse.setHeader (_http_outgoing.js:561:11) at sendJson (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\api-utils.js:37:5) at ServerResponse.apiRes.json (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\api-utils.js:6:297) at me (C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:239:16) at C:\Users\JoaoTI\Desktop\DashGo-ReactJs.next\server\pages\api\me.js:186:12 at apiResolver (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\api-utils.js:8:7) at runMicrotasks () at processTicksAndRejections (internal/process/task_queues.js:95:5) at async DevServer.handleApiRequest (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:67:462) at async Object.fn (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:59:492) at async Router.execute (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\router.js:25:67) at async DevServer.run (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:69:1042) at async DevServer.handleRequest (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:34:504) { code: 'ERR_HTTP_HEADERS_SENT' } events.js:377 throw er; // Unhandled 'error' event ^

    Error [ERR_STREAM_WRITE_AFTER_END]: write after end at new NodeError (internal/errors.js:322:7) at writeAfterEnd (_http_outgoing.js:694:15) at ServerResponse.end (_http_outgoing.js:815:7) at ServerResponse.end (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\compiled\compression\index.js:1:141519) at sendError (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\api-utils.js:62:129) at apiResolver (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\api-utils.js:8:405) at runMicrotasks () at processTicksAndRejections (internal/process/task_queues.js:95:5) at async DevServer.handleApiRequest (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:67:462) at async Object.fn (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:59:492) at async Router.execute (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\router.js:25:67) at async DevServer.run (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:69:1042) at async DevServer.handleRequest (C:\Users\JoaoTI\Desktop\DashGo-ReactJs\node_modules\next\dist\next-server\server\next-server.js:34:504) Emitted 'error' event on ServerResponse instance at: at writeAfterEndNT (_http_outgoing.js:753:7) at processTicksAndRejections (internal/process/task_queues.js:83:21) { code: 'ERR_STREAM_WRITE_AFTER_END' } error Command failed with exit code 1.

    opened by jaoribeiro-0211 0
Owner
Gabriel Fiusa
Desenvolvedor Front-End | ReactJS | AngularJS | Javascript | Typescript
Gabriel Fiusa
Painel para pesquisa e exibição de dados de usuários do Github. Foram utilizados a biblioteca React e a API da plataforma.

React - GitHub User Search Sobre Esse projeto foi criado com a biblioteca React JS e com os dados provenientes da GitHub API. Trata-se de uma página p

Leonardo Teixeira 8 Apr 24, 2022
Free Open Source High Quality Dashboard based on Bootstrap 4 & React 16: http://dashboards.webkom.co/react/airframe

Airframe React High Quality Dashboard / Admin / Analytics template that works great on any smartphone, tablet or desktop. Available as Open Source as

Mustafa Nabavi 6 Jun 5, 2022
Aplicação para o envio de postagens.

LinkedIn Clone Aplicação para o envio de postagens. ☕ Usando LinkedIn Clone Para usar LinkedIn Clone, clique no link abaixo: ![Link] ?? Tecnologias As

Gabriel Moreira 8 Aug 5, 2022
Basic React Project with React Router, ContextAPI and Login

Getting Started with Create React App This project was bootstrapped with Create React App. Available Scripts In the project directory, you can run: np

null 26 Jan 3, 2023
Podcastr é uma plataforma construída para transmissão de podcast.

Podcastr ??️ ?? Descrição Podcastr é uma plataforma construída para transmissão de podcast. Website: podcastr-evander.vercel.app ?? Tecnologias Esse p

Evander Inácio 4 Nov 10, 2022
Site para treinar minhas habilidades com o react no frontEnd (totalmente voltado para o aprendizado)

Tutorial Getting Started with Create React App This project was bootstrapped with Create React App. Available Scripts In the project directory, you ca

Júlia de Melo Albuquerque 3 Jan 31, 2022
Sistema de controle financeiro em ReactJS / Typescript

Sistema de controle financeiro em ReactJS / Typescript Sistema de controle financeiro que organiza e calcula mensalmente a receita, despesa e o balanç

Gabriel de S. Martim 2 Jun 26, 2022
Aplicação web desenvolvida durante a Imersão React #3 da Alura

Sobre o projeto ?? O Alurakut é uma aplicação web clone do nosso queridíssimo e já falecido Orkut, porém trazendo uma interface mais moderna e utiliza

Vinícius Figueiroa 35 May 2, 2022
🚀 Aplicação mobile com React Native produzida durante o Next Level Week #05

✨ Tecnologias Esse projeto foi desenvolvido com as seguintes tecnologias: React Native Typescript Expo ?? Projeto Aplicativo para lhe ajudar a lembrar

Danilo Alexandrino 11 May 28, 2022
Projeto criado na NLW eSport da RocketSeat. Voltado ao universo de games para conectar pessoas que precisam de um duo para jogar!

NLW eSports O que é o NLW? NLW é o maior evento online e gratuito de programação na prática com muito código, desafios, networking e um único objetivo

Ranielli Montagna 2 Sep 15, 2022